1 SEC. 16346. FEES FOR AN INDIVIDUAL REGISTERED OR SEEKING
2 REGISTRATION AS A REGISTERED NUTRITIONIST AND DIETITIAN UNDER
3 PART 183A ARE AS FOLLOWS:
4 (A) APPLICATION PROCESSING FEE......................... $20.00
5 (B) REGISTRATION FEE, PER YEAR......................... $25.00
6 PART 183A. NUTRITION AND DIETETICS
7 SEC. 18351. (1) AS USED IN THIS PART, "REGISTERED NUTRI-
8 TIONIST AND DIETITIAN", EXCEPT AS OTHERWISE PROVIDED IN SUBSEC-
9 TION (2), MEANS AN INDIVIDUAL WHO INTEGRATES AND APPLIES SCIEN-
10 TIFIC PRINCIPLES OF FOOD, NUTRITION, BIOCHEMISTRY, PHYSIOLOGY,
11 MANAGEMENT, AND BEHAVIORAL AND SOCIAL SCIENCES TO ACHIEVE AND
12 MAINTAIN THE HEALTH OF INDIVIDUALS THROUGH THE PROVISION OF
13 NUTRITION CARE SERVICES, ADMINISTRATIVE SERVICES, COUNSELING
14 SERVICES, EDUCATIONAL SERVICES, FOOD SERVICES, FOOD SAFETY SERV-
15 ICES, INFORMATIONAL SERVICES, NUTRITION THERAPY SERVICES, MANAGE-
16 MENT SERVICES, AND SAFETY AND SANITATION SERVICES AND IS REGIS-
17 TERED AS A NUTRITIONIST AND DIETITIAN UNDER THIS ARTICLE.
18 (2) REGISTERED NUTRITIONIST AND DIETITIAN DOES NOT INCLUDE
19 AN INDIVIDUAL WHO DOES 1 OR MORE OF THE FOLLOWING:
20 (A) FURNISHES INFORMATION ON FOODS, FOOD PRODUCTS, OR
21 DIETARY SUPPLEMENTS IN CONNECTION WITH THE MARKETING OR DISTRIBU-
22 TION OF THOSE FOODS, FOOD PRODUCTS, OR DIETARY SUPPLEMENTS, AS
23 LONG AS HE OR SHE DOES NOT HOLD HIMSELF OR HERSELF OUT AS A REG-
24 ISTERED NUTRITIONIST AND DIETITIAN.
25 (B) PROVIDES WEIGHT CONTROL SERVICES.
26 (3) IN ADDITION TO THE DEFINITIONS IN THIS PART, ARTICLE 1
27 CONTAINS GENERAL DEFINITIONS AND PRINCIPLES OF CONSTRUCTION

3 SEC. 18353. BEGINNING ON THE EFFECTIVE DATE OF THE AMENDA-
4 TORY ACT THAT ADDED THIS PART, AN INDIVIDUAL SHALL NOT USE THE
5 TITLES "REGISTERED NUTRITIONIST AND DIETITIAN" OR "R.N.D." OR
6 SIMILAR WORDS THAT INDICATE THAT THE INDIVIDUAL IS A REGISTERED
7 NUTRITIONIST AND DIETITIAN, UNLESS THE INDIVIDUAL IS REGISTERED
8 UNDER THIS ARTICLE AS A REGISTERED NUTRITIONIST AND DIETITIAN.
9 SEC. 18355. THE MICHIGAN BOARD OF NUTRITION AND DIETETICS
10 IS CREATED IN THE DEPARTMENT AND CONSISTS OF THE FOLLOWING 7
11 VOTING MEMBERS WHO MEET THE REQUIREMENTS OF PART 161:
12 (A) TWO PUBLIC MEMBERS.
13 (B) FIVE MEMBERS WHO ARE REGISTERED DIETITIANS AND NUTRI-
14 TIONISTS AND WHO MEET THE REQUIREMENTS OF SECTION 16135(2) AND
15 BOTH OF THE FOLLOWING REQUIREMENTS:
16 (i) POSSESS A BACCALAUREATE OR HIGHER DEGREE FROM A UNITED
17 STATES REGIONALLY ACCREDITED INSTITUTION OF HIGHER EDUCATION
18 APPROVED BY THE DEPARTMENT WITH A MAJOR COURSE OF STUDY IN HUMAN
19 NUTRITION, NUTRITION EDUCATION, FOODS AND NUTRITION, DIETETICS,
20 OR FOOD SYSTEMS MANAGEMENT APPROVED BY THE DEPARTMENT. AN APPLI-
21 CANT FOR THE INITIAL BOARD WHO HAS OBTAINED HIS OR HER EDUCATION
22 OUTSIDE OF THE UNITED STATES OR ITS TERRITORIES SHALL HAVE HIS OR
23 HER ACADEMIC DEGREE VALIDATED BY THE DEPARTMENT AS EQUIVALENT TO
24 A BACCALAUREATE OR HIGHER DEGREE CONFERRED BY A UNITED STATES
25 REGIONALLY ACCREDITED INSTITUTION OF HIGHER EDUCATION APPROVED BY
26 THE DEPARTMENT.
01440'01
7
1 (ii) HAVE NOT LESS THAN 900 HOURS OF SUPERVISED POSTCOLLEGE
2 OR PLANNED CONTINUOUS AND VERIFIABLE PREPROFESSIONAL EXPERIENCE
3 APPROVED BY THE DEPARTMENT.
4 SEC. 18357. THE DEPARTMENT SHALL ISSUE A REGISTRATION TO AN
5 INDIVIDUAL WHO APPLIES ON A FORM PRESCRIBED BY THE DEPARTMENT,
6 PAYS THE APPLICABLE FEES UNDER SECTION 16346, AND MEETS ALL OF
7 THE FOLLOWING REQUIREMENTS:
8 (A) POSSESSES A BACCALAUREATE DEGREE FROM A UNITED STATES
9 REGIONALLY ACCREDITED INSTITUTION OF HIGHER EDUCATION APPROVED BY
10 THE DEPARTMENT WITH A MAJOR COURSE OF STUDY IN HUMAN NUTRITION,
11 NUTRITION EDUCATION, FOODS AND NUTRITION, DIETETICS, OR FOOD SYS-
12 TEMS MANAGEMENT, OR AN EQUIVALENT COURSE OF STUDY, AS APPROVED BY
13 THE DEPARTMENT.
14 (B) HAS NOT LESS THAN 900 HOURS OF SUPERVISED POSTCOLLEGE OR
15 PLANNED CONTINUOUS PREPROFESSIONAL EXPERIENCE AS PRESCRIBED IN
16 RULES PROMULGATED BY THE DEPARTMENT.
17 (C) PASSES AN EXAMINATION THAT IS APPROVED BY THE
18 DEPARTMENT.
19 SEC. 18359. A REGISTRATION ISSUED BY THE DEPARTMENT UNDER
20 SECTION 18357 IS RENEWABLE UPON PAYMENT OF THE PRESCRIBED REGIS-
21 TRATION RENEWAL FEE. NOTWITHSTANDING THE REQUIREMENTS OF
22 PART 161 AND BEGINNING WITH THE SECOND RENEWAL PERIOD AFTER THE
23 EFFECTIVE DATE OF THIS PART, THE BOARD MAY REQUIRE A REGISTRANT
24 SEEKING RENEWAL OF A REGISTRATION TO FURNISH THE BOARD WITH EVI-
25 DENCE THAT DURING THE 1 YEAR BEFORE AN APPLICATION FOR RENEWAL
26 THE REGISTRANT HAS ATTENDED CONTINUING EDUCATION COURSES OR
27 PROGRAMS APPROVED BY THE BOARD AND TOTALING NOT LESS THAN 12
